Output 89506f8afa2ab88300cb17f63ea55d4efe1b4798d7ec7744ee4c862bf1836e63:12

value
102163
script pubkey
OP_0 OP_PUSHBYTES_32 5c70d7837998952723cc9f4fce9bc445af6ae5f30eaff82fba85ac660917ab5c
address
bc1qt3cd0qmenz2jwg7vna8uax7ygkhk4e0np6hlsta6skkxvzgh4dwq586f44
transaction
89506f8afa2ab88300cb17f63ea55d4efe1b4798d7ec7744ee4c862bf1836e63
confirmations
911
spent
true